使用更改表跟踪

时间:2012-11-16 21:56:03

标签: sql-server sql-server-2008

我需要使用sql server 2008更改的表跟踪功能。我在许多表上启用了此功能。现在我必须编写一个同步程序来将这些数据传输到另一个位置。  我的问题是如何才能获得那些数据已经更改的表,而不必遍历所有已更改的表列表并检查每个表?

1 个答案:

答案 0 :(得分:0)

尝试sys.CHANGE_TRACKING_TABLES(记录on MSDN here)。

您必须使用OBJECT_NAME从第一列获取表名。